[wp-trac] [WordPress Trac] #37974: Add multi-panel feature to pages through add_theme_support

WordPress Trac noreply at wordpress.org
Tue Oct 18 07:07:17 UTC 2016


#37974: Add multi-panel feature to pages through add_theme_support
-----------------------------------------+------------------
 Reporter:  karmatosed                   |       Owner:
     Type:  task (blessed)               |      Status:  new
 Priority:  normal                       |   Milestone:  4.7
Component:  Themes                       |     Version:
 Severity:  normal                       |  Resolution:
 Keywords:  has-ux-feedback needs-patch  |     Focuses:  ui
-----------------------------------------+------------------

Comment (by nikeo):

 Replying to [comment:156 westonruter]:
 > @karmatosed After I commented, actually, I also had pangs of guilt for
 suggesting that the functionality be added to the theme as opposed to a
 plugin. So yeah, +1 on going the feature plugin route. I just wish there
 was a way to have the plugin auto-install and activate with the activation
 of Twenty Seventeen, but alas we don't have dependency mechanism yet. I
 don't suppose the feature plugin should be bundled with core either like
 Akismet. Should there be a prompt somewhere for users to install the
 plugin?

 Hello, I'm jumping into the discussion to add a quick comment about the
 plugin dependencies : theme authors like me are encouraged by the Theme
 Review admins to use the TGM Plugin Activation.

 There have been TRT discussions about this
 [here]https://make.wordpress.org/themes/2015/03/26/theme-review-team-
 weekly-notes-the-logs-are-9/ and
 [here]https://make.wordpress.org/themes/2015/07/28/theme-review-team-
 weekly-meeting-notes-the-logs-7/.

 This multi-panel feature proposal is excellent, and I do agree with
 @westonruter that it might be a benefit for the final specifications to
 iterate on it in a plugin first.

--
Ticket URL: <https://core.trac.wordpress.org/ticket/37974#comment:161>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list